Pirates shock Supersport United   
Premier Soccer League
Second-half goals from Issa Sarr and Sifiso Myeni secured a 2-1 come from behind victory for Orlando Pirates over a 10-man SuperSport United outfit in an Absa Premiership encounter at the Peter Mokaba Stadium in Polokwane on Sunday afternoon.
